Cyber Security Specialist

View this career for different education levels:

A cyber security specialist helps to protect computers, networks, and important information from people who might try to steal or damage them. They look for weaknesses in computer systems, set up special software to keep computers safe, and respond quickly if there is a cyber attack. Their job is very important for businesses, schools, hospitals, and even the government to make sure private information stays safe. Most cyber security specialists work in offices and use computers every day. They need to be good at solving problems and enjoy learning new things about technology because the world of computers is always changing.
